Installation - Mechanical
7. Move the next mating section into alignment with the
positioned section. Alignment of sections must be
completed before gasket surfaces meet. The two
sections should be within 12 inches to reduce the
amount of dragging required.
8. Remove lifting lugs on mating section as required. The
nuts and bolts from the lifting lugs should be used to
attach the sections together.
9. Pulling sections together on a flat surface can be done
by using chain come-alongs hooked onto the welded
pull tubes located on each side of the shipping split.
These square tubes are designed to fully support the
stress of pulling sections together. Pulling the unit
evenly on both sides will ensure connecting plates will
line up. Sections should be pulled together until
mating gaskets make contact and factory-supplied
bolts can be installed in connecting plate.

10. When sections are close enough to allow full threading
of the factory-supplied nut onto the bolt, chain come-
alongs can be removed. The use of an electric impact
gun to tighten bolts in a sequential manner will allow
the additional section to be pulled into the final
position.
11. Check overall unit length to assure proper joint
compression.
Note: Failure to compress the gasketing may result in air
leakage.
12. Once the sections are pulled together, install the
assembly hardware as applicable for the walls, roof,
and the base as demonstrated in the following
assembly sections.
